Slate roof leak repair services involve identifying and addressing leaks in slate roofing systems to prevent water intrusion and property damage. Skilled contractors typically conduct thorough inspections to locate the source of leaks, which may be caused by cracked, broken, or missing slate tiles, as well as damaged flashing or underlying roofing materials. Once the problem areas are identified, repairs may include replacing damaged slate tiles, sealing gaps, or repairing flashing components to restore the roof’s integrity. Proper repair techniques are essential to maintain the roof’s durability and prevent further issues caused by ongoing water infiltration.

Properties that typically utilize slate roof leak repair services include historic homes, commercial buildings, and upscale residential properties with traditional or high-end roofing systems. Slate roofs are valued for their aesthetic appeal and long lifespan, making them a popular choice for buildings with architectural significance or those seeking a distinctive, durable roofing material. Due to the weight and specific installation requirements of slate, repairs often require specialized knowledge and skills, which local service providers can provide to ensure the work is performed correctly.

Cost Range for Slate Roof Leak Repair - The typical cost for repairing a slate roof leak varies from approximately $500 to $2,500 depending on the extent of damage and repair complexity. Small repairs, such as replacing a few damaged slates, tend to be on the lower end, while extensive repairs may approach higher figures.
Factors Influencing Pricing - Costs can fluctuate based on the size of the roof, accessibility, and the severity of the leak. For example, a localized leak might cost around $600, whereas a widespread issue could reach $3,000 or more.
Average Service Charges - Local pros typically charge between $1,000 and $3,000 for comprehensive slate roof leak repairs. This includes inspection, materials, and labor, with prices varying by project specifics.
Additional Cost Considerations - Unexpected issues like underlying structural damage or extensive slate replacement can increase costs beyond initial estimates. It's advisable to obtain detailed quotes from local service providers for accurate pricing.

What causes slate roof leaks? Leaks can result from damaged or cracked slates, faulty flashing, or issues with the roof's underlayment, allowing water to penetrate the roof structure.
How can I identify a slate roof leak? Signs include water stains on ceilings or walls, missing or damaged slates, and water dripping inside the attic or living spaces.
Are repairs to slate roof leaks complex? Repairing slate roof leaks often requires specialized knowledge to ensure the integrity of the roof is maintained and additional damage is avoided.
